Lucas Oil Speedway Spotlight: Vintage Cars a perfect fit for racing veteran Clevenger

WHEATLAND, MO. (July 28, 2021) - Fans attending Saturday night’s dirt-track action at Lucas Oil Speedway might feel like they’ve taken a trip back in time when the Show-Me Vintage Racers - a special guest class - take to the speedway for their annual appearance.

SMVR President Mickey Fleehart said he expects 20-24 cars - ranging from 1930s body styles to 1970s types - to enter the action. The cars will be on the Lucas Oil Speedway midway for up-close viewing prior to the Big Adventure RV Weekly Racing Series program.

Damon Clevenger of Parkville drives a 1939 Chevy Sedan body on a later-model Chevelle stub with a Modified chassis underneath. Powered by a Chevy 358 motor, it’s one of the faster cars in the division and always an attention-grabber for its looks.

“People like the older cars because you don’t see them much anymore,” Clevenger said. “We always get some fans who come by and take a look.”

Clevenger said the Show-Me Vintage Racers, with a 15-event schedule in 2021 with most of the events at I-35 Speedway in Winston, always enjoy visiting Lucas Oil Speedway. Clevenger won the race at Wheatland in 2019 and wound up a close second last year when Jeremy Turner passed him on the final lap in his '73 Chevelle.

“I like them because they’re more affordable than a lot of cars,” Clevenger said of the Vintage car division, adding that the limited schedule is just the right amount of racing for him to stay involved in the sport.

“I raced for several years weekly and you get burned out after a while,” Clevenger said. “When you don’t race weekly it makes it a little easier. It’s just me and my Dad working on the car and turning wrenches on it.”

Clevenger, 52, has been racing on and off since going to Lakeside Speedway and Riverside Speedway near Kansas City to watch his dad Louis and uncle Joe race as a youngster. He later drove a Ford Pinto in the 4-cylinder division and won a track championship in the 4-cylinder class at I-70 in a Ford Mustang.

“Then we put together a Super Truck and raced it until I-70 closed in about 2008,” Clevenger said. “I took a few years off and just went and watched my dad and uncle, who got back in Vintage class. We had enough parts laying around, dad put together another Vintage car. My uncle retired three years ago when he was 76.

“The car I’m in now is the one my uncle was driving. It’s been a really good car. I’m just out there having fun.”

Spending time with his Dad makes it extra special. Even better, the team has three wins in seven attempts this season.

“This is my 23rd year racing full-sized cars,” Clevenger said. “I’ve been done racing a few times and kept in it because Dad wanted to keep in it. For me, it’s the time I get to spend with Dad. That’s the biggest part of the joy I get out of racing now. We get to go out and have fun.”

The Big Adventure RV Weekly Racing Series program on Saturday is Fan Appreciation Night Presented by the OzarksCW/O-zone. Festivities will begin with John Schneider, who played Bo Duke on the iconic television program "Dukes of Hazzard," singing the National Anthem with Schneider and his wife Alicia also racing B-Mods in the Ozarks Golf Cars USRA B-Mod division.

The Cedar Creek Beef Jerky USRA Modifieds will be the features class, with a 25-lap, $1,000-to-win main event. O'Reilly Auto Parts USRA Stock Cars and ULMA Late Models will join the two modified classes and the Vintage Racers.

There will be food and drink specials throughout the evening, including $1 nachos & Cheese, $2 hot dogs and $2 soft drinks or water.

The big weekend begins on Friday with a Car Show prior to Schneider's "Bo's On The Road Extravaganza" concert and a showing of his movie "Stand On It" on the video board.

On Saturday, Day One of the Kentucky Drag Boat Association Summer Shootout will take place the morning and afternoon on Lake Lucas. Both Saturday and on Sunday, for the final half of the Summer Shootout, kids can play on a 35-foot-long wet water slide/bounce house combo that will be set up on the drag boat midway.
There also will be corn-hole boards under the beer tent.

On Sunday prior to the beginning of Day 2 of the KDBA Summer Shootout, Schneider will hold Cowboy Church services along with a pastor from Racers for Christ at Lake Lucas.
